Commissioners approve small county contribution increase for Tacoma Stephens County Airport projects

Stephens County Board of Commissioners · August 27, 2025

Stephens County commissioners approved a budget amendment to increase the county's contribution to capital projects at the Tacoma Stephens County Airport Authority by $9,891, bringing the county's total obligation to $20,391 for the fiscal year. The funds will support additional capital work at the airport, including construction of asphalt surfaces.

Staff explained the state will contribute a small matching share of local costs and the city of Tacoma will share part of the local obligation; the city had already agreed. Commissioners moved and seconded approval; the motion carried.
